求救!MySQL数据库密码忘记了!(mysql数据库密码忘记)
求救!MySQL数据库密码忘记了!
在使用MySQL数据库的过程中,我们会遇到一种尴尬的情况,就是忘记MySQL的ROOT密码。尽管MySQL的 ROOT密码是非常重要的,但是它也可能会让我们烦恼!如果你正遇到这类问题,不用担心,下面云象 MySQL小编就介绍一下什么是MySQL密码,以及忘记MySQL密码后如何恢复和重设ROOT密码。
首先,让我们先了解什么是MySQL密码?MySQL数据库提供了一个特殊的ROOT用户,ROOT用户可以连接数据库,访问数据库中的表,执行各种操作等等,也就是说,ROOT用户有着非常强大的权限。因此,MySQL数据库的ROOT用户需要设定一个密码来保护免受恶意攻击,这就是MySQL密码。
在一般情况下,MySQL ROOT密码是随机生成的,也就是你在安装MySQL服务器的时候,会得到一个初始的MySQL ROOT密码,但是这个初始的MySQL ROOT密码经常会被忘记,从而导致无法正常登录到MySQL服务器。
那么,如果忘记MySQL ROOT密码怎么办?以下方法可以帮助你重新设置MySQL密码:
首先,使用”–skip-grant-tables”参数重新启动MySQL服务,这个参数会跳过权限检查,使得我们可以在没有密码的情况下连接MySQL服务器;
其次,登录到MySQL服务器,使用下面的命令重设ROOT密码:
mysql> update user set password=password('新密码') where user='root';
最后,重新启动MySQL服务,使用新密码登录MySQL服务器即可!
为了避免遇到类似的情况,我们最好要记录MySQL ROOT密码,并定期更改MySQL ROOT 密码保证安全!